How to Create Successful Collaborative Construction

Ensuring Your Construction Team Clearly Communicate

 

Working together is a part of everyday life, whether it’s in the office or on a construction site. The construction industry relies on team-based projects to operate and be successful with numerous managers, contractors, and subcontractors needing to work together. To help create successful collaboration in your construction projects, read on.

 

Change project delivery methods

Some contractors are choosing to use construction management software to help streamline communication and collaboration on the job site. This allows trade contractors to maintain consistent communication and effectively remedy any errors or delays. There are many ways to transition your communications from paper to digital, and many benefits of doing so, too.

 

Emphasize accountability

Successful project managers understand which tasks to delegate to team members appropriately. The goal is to complete the work efficiently and effectively, and one person cannot do it all.

 

Be open to change

Transforming into a collaborative construction company can be tricky, and it’s a fact that people don’t like change. What’s more, new problems can arise when switching to a collaboration-based construction firm. It’s important to remember that hurdles will happen along the way and to be prepared for them. Respond to these potential issues to minimize problems that can come with people switching to collaborative construction.
